Just a stone's throw from Antwerp, in Kruibeke along the Scheldt, lies the largest flood plain in Flanders. No need to flood it only happens a few times a year. All other days of the year you can hike, cycle, play or fish: it's all possible in the Polders of Kruibeke. Through the paths you can be guided through a varied landscape of mudflats and salt marshes, alder forests and meadow birds.
